About The Role

We’re looking for a Lead People & Culture Business Partner to play a critical role in shaping how Mortgage Advice Bureau (MAB) grows and evolves as a high performing business. This is a senior, strategic HR leadership role, partnering with Executive and Senior Leaders to translate business strategy into impactful people plans. You’ll lead a team of 4 People & Culture Business Partners, ensuring we deliver a consistent, high-quality partnering approach that drives organisational effectiveness, capability and culture. You’ll balance long‑term strategic thinking with hands‑on delivery, acting as a trusted advisor during periods of change and transformation.
